Kampala University has a branch in Tanzania known as Kampala International University in Tanzania (KIUT).

Here are some key details about it:

Kampala International University in Tanzania (KIUT):

1) Location.

KIUT is located in Gongo la Mboto, Dar es Salaam, Tanzania.

2) Establishment.

The university was established to provide higher education opportunities to Tanzanian students and students from the East African region.

3) Programs.

KIUT offers various undergraduate and postgraduate programs across different fields such as Health Sciences, Business, Law, Education, and Social Sciences.

Check out: Courses Offered At Kampala International University in Tanzania (KIUT).

4) Accreditation.

KIUT is accredited by the Tanzania Commission for Universities (TCU), ensuring that the programs meet the educational standards required by the Tanzanian government.

5) Facilities.

The university provides various facilities to support learning and research, including libraries, laboratories, and modern classrooms.
